How $60 Brent Crude Fuels Construction Cost Increases

The primary transmission mechanism between oil prices and construction costs is energy. Transporting raw materials like cement, steel, and aggregates across Brazil's vast distances relies heavily on diesel-fueled trucks. At $60/barrel, the cost of diesel, a refined petroleum product, rises. For instance, a 10% increase in crude oil prices typically translates to a 5-7% increase in diesel prices at the pump in Brazil, assuming unchanged taxes and refining margins. This directly pushes up freight costs. Furthermore, many energy-intensive components of construction, such as steel production (which uses natural gas or electricity often generated from fossil fuels) and the manufacture of plastics (derived from petrochemicals), experience upward pressure. Bitumen, a key component in asphalt for roads, is a direct derivative of crude oil, so its price would rise proportionally. This means projects requiring significant paving or foundation work will see immediate cost hikes.

Brazil-Specific Factors Exacerbating the Impact

Brazil's continental scale and reliance on road transport make it particularly vulnerable to oil price fluctuations. Approximately 60% of all cargo in Brazil is transported by road. This extensive reliance means that even a modest increase in diesel costs at $60 Brent has an outsized impact on the final price of materials delivered to construction sites. Furthermore, Brazil's complex tax structure, including ICMS (State Value-Added Tax) on fuel, means that the absolute price of diesel at the pump is already high, and a percentage increase on this base figure results in a larger nominal increase for transporters. Supply chain inefficiencies and a lack of alternative, cheaper transport options like rail in many regions further amplify the effect. Public housing projects, often located in peripheral areas, face these magnified transport costs more acutely.

Concrete Impact on Low-Income Households at $60 Brent

Consider a low-income household in Brazil, earning approximately R$7,500 (€1,400) per month, looking to undertake a modest home renovation or build an extension. At $60/barrel Brent, let's project the impact. A standard bag of cement (50kg), which might cost R$30 before the increase, could climb to R$33-R$34 due to increased production and transport costs. For a small renovation requiring 50 bags, this adds R$150-R$200 to the material bill. More significantly, the cost of a basic construction service, such as hiring a small truck to deliver sand or gravel, could increase by 8-12%, from R$300 to R$324-R$336 per trip, largely due to higher fuel costs for the driver.

For families aiming to build a 50m² basic house, the overall construction cost could rise by 3-5% compared to periods of lower oil prices. If the base cost for such a project was R$80,000 (€15,000), a 4% increase equates to an additional R$3,200 (€600). This extra burden, when spread over a typical home financing period, translates to an increase of R$25-R$30 (€4.5-€5.5) per month on a loan payment – a tangible hit to a tight household budget. This amount could represent a significant portion of their discretionary spending, or even impact their ability to afford other necessities.

Strategies for Low-Income Households

Given these challenges, low-income households can adopt several strategies. Firstly, prioritize essential repairs or improvements, deferring non-critical projects until market conditions stabilize. Secondly, explore local material sourcing to minimize transport costs – buying from closer suppliers or directly from smaller, local producers. Thirdly, consider seeking government renovation grants or subsidized loan programs that may help offset some increased costs. Finally, engage in community-led building initiatives where shared resources and labor can reduce individual financial burdens.
